One of the most significant updates allows the iPhone 13 lineup, including the iPhone 13 Mini, iPhone 13 Pro, and iPhone 13 Pro Max, to use carrier-provided satellite messaging services. This feature was previously limited to newer iPhone models, but with iOS 18.5, T-Mobile customers can now access Starlink-powered satellite messaging.
Satellite Messaging: A Game-Changer for iPhone 13 Users
Satellite messaging is one of the standout features of iOS 18.5. While iPhone 14 and newer models already support Apple's Emergency SOS via satellite, the iPhone 13 now gains access to carrier-provided satellite features. T-Mobile users in the US can experience Starlink’s satellite messaging for free during its trial phase, which runs until July. However, it's essential to note that iPhone 13 users won’t have access to Apple's Emergency SOS satellite services, a feature exclusive to iPhone 14 and beyond.
New Features and Enhancements in iOS 18.5
Besides satellite messaging, iOS 18.5 includes several other updates that enhance user experience. One of the notable changes is the addition of a Pride Harmony wallpaper to celebrate inclusivity and diversity. For parents, there's also a useful new feature: notifications when a child uses the Screen Time passcode on their device. This improvement aims to give parents more control and visibility over their child's device usage.
Bug Fixes and Minor Improvements
iOS 18.5 also addresses several bug fixes to improve the overall functionality of the system. For instance, it resolves an issue where the Apple Vision Pro app would sometimes display a black screen, ensuring smoother app performance. Additionally, Apple has expanded its Buy with iPhone feature, allowing users to purchase content directly within the Apple TV app on third-party devices.
